THEME:   phrases missing the first word, TAKE
   
GOOD ONES:     
Title:  "Misstakes"   
Record listings?   CRIMES [not LP's]    
Openings to fill   CAVITIES [not jobs]   
Ties in Tokyo   OBIS [not relationships]   
Cooler in hot weather   ICE TEA  [not the state of being]   
O staff, briefly   EDS [Oprah's magazine]   
   
BTW:   
Not ANGSTE again! --- it was poor last week and hasn't gotten any better.   
   
MACHE and TREF are also not English.   
   
Oddly, the theme clues without the verb take are syntactically not parallel.  It's not a problem today because the theme requires the verb --- unlike yesterday's outright lack of concern for language structure.
